Finding the Right Problem

The best micro-SaaS ideas are vitamin → painkiller conversions. Take something people do manually and automate it.

Examples:

  • Resize images for social media → One-click tool
  • Write commit messages → AI generator
  • Convert markdown to blog format → Multi-platform converter

The Tech Stack (Total Cost: $0)

LayerToolCost
FrontendHTML + CSS + JSFree
AI FeaturesGemini API (BYOK)Free (user pays)
HostingVercel HobbyFree
PaymentsStripe Payment Links2.9% + $0.30/tx
Domain.vercel.app subdomainFree

Hour 5-8: Add the Freemium Gate

The key to monetization without a backend:

  • Free: Basic features
  • Pro ($4.99/month): Advanced features, higher limits, no watermark

Use localStorage for client-side gating and Stripe Payment Links for checkout.

Real Numbers

From my own experience launching 6 tools:

  • Development time per tool: 2-4 hours
  • Monthly hosting cost: $0
  • Time to first user: < 24 hours (via Dev.to traffic)
  • Revenue potential: $50-500/month per tool
